/**
|
|
* Ring Configuration Loader
|
|
*
|
|
* Implements a 4-layer configuration system:
|
|
* 1. Built-in defaults
|
|
* 2. User config: ~/.config/opencode/ring/config.jsonc (or .json)
|
|
* 3. Project config: .opencode/ring.jsonc or .ring/config.jsonc
|
|
* 4. Directory overrides: .ring/local.jsonc
|
|
*/

/**
|
|
* Keys that must never be merged/assigned from untrusted input.
|
|
*
|
|
* These are the common gadget keys used for prototype pollution.
|
|
*/
|
|
const FORBIDDEN_OBJECT_KEYS = new Set(["__proto__", "constructor", "prototype"])
|
|
|
|
function isForbiddenObjectKey(key: string): boolean {
|
|
return FORBIDDEN_OBJECT_KEYS.has(key)
|
|
}
|
|
|
|
function isMergeableObject(value: unknown): value is Record<string, unknown> {
|
|
if (value === null || typeof value !== "object" || Array.isArray(value)) {
|
|
return false
|
|
}
|
|
|
|
// Only merge plain objects (or null-prototype maps)
|
|
const proto = Object.getPrototypeOf(value)
|
|
return proto === Object.prototype || proto === null
|
|
}
|
|
|
|
/**
|
|
* Deep merge two objects, with source overwriting target.
|
|
* Arrays are replaced, not merged.
|
|
*
|
|
* SECURITY: Defends against prototype pollution by:
|
|
* - using null-prototype result objects (Object.create(null))
|
|
* - skipping forbidden gadget keys (__proto__/constructor/prototype)
|
|
*
|
|
* @param target - The base object
|
|
* @param source - The object to merge in
|
|
* @returns Merged object
|
|
*/
|
|
export function deepMerge<T extends Record<string, unknown>>(target: T, source: Partial<T>): T {
|
|
const result = Object.create(null) as T
|
|
|
|
// Copy existing keys from target (excluding forbidden keys)
|
|
for (const [key, value] of Object.entries(target)) {
|
|
if (isForbiddenObjectKey(key)) continue
|
|
;(result as Record<string, unknown>)[key] = value
|
|
}
|
|
|
|
if (!isMergeableObject(source)) {
|
|
return result
|
|
}
|
|
|
|
for (const key of Object.keys(source)) {
|
|
if (isForbiddenObjectKey(key)) {
|
|
continue
|
|
}
|
|
|
|
const sourceValue = (source as Record<string, unknown>)[key]
|
|
const targetValue = (target as Record<string, unknown>)[key]
|
|
|
|
if (sourceValue === undefined) {
|
|
continue
|
|
}
|
|
|
|
if (isMergeableObject(sourceValue) && isMergeableObject(targetValue)) {
|
|
;(result as Record<string, unknown>)[key] = deepMerge(
|
|
targetValue as Record<string, unknown>,
|
|
sourceValue as Record<string, unknown>,
|
|
)
|
|
} else {
|
|
;(result as Record<string, unknown>)[key] = sourceValue
|
|
}
|
|
}
|
|
|
|
return result
|
|
}
